Output 9ec44ec24a8797bcd1e0a19e732548b36a81a2ec5f3ee564f1a7dec899cecd17:3

value
11322709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96cf5c9dd86d67c416501fdf10da053250a7fbc OP_EQUAL
address
3L44GnN3tG41VHQFN67HZeEaXMCjkYUYnS
transaction
9ec44ec24a8797bcd1e0a19e732548b36a81a2ec5f3ee564f1a7dec899cecd17
spent
true